Technical nuances of temporal muscle dissection and reconstruction for the pterional keyhole craniotomy.

2013 
The supraorbital keyhole approach offers a limited access for aneurysms located at the middle cerebral artery (MCA) bifurcation with long M1 segments or proximal M2 aneurysms. Alternative minimally invasive routes centered on the pterion have been developed to address these aneurysms. Appropriate dissection and reconstruction of the temporal muscle are important for optimal exposure and best cosmetic results with the pterional keyhole craniotomy. The authors describe the technical nuances of temporal muscle dissection and reconstruction adapted to the pterional keyhole craniotomy. After incising the scalp in a curvilinear fashion behind the hairline, an interfascial dissection is performed, allowing anterior reflection of the superficial temporal fat pat and superficial temporal fascia. The temporal muscle is incised 7–10 mm below its insertion at the superior temporal line. The deep temporal fascia and temporal muscle are incised vertically, completing a T-shaped incision.
